Some tips on a successful Block Garage Sale.

  1. A group sale is better then selling alone.  More stuff draws more traffic
  2. Advertise – stick an ad in the newspaper, and get your signs out early.
  3. Be prepared.  Be ready to go the night before so that you don’t have to rush around in the morning.
  4. Play background music, this will draw your customers in, complete silence can be uncomfortable.  Don’t play offensive music, play something appropriate for your audience, something fun and catchy.
  5. Plan you sale layout with customers in mind.  Use marketing tricks to make your customers more likely to purchse your stuff!
  6. Price things carefully.
  7. Label things well.
  8. Be friendly. Greet people as they arrive – chat if they’re chatty.
  9. DO NOT  bad-mouth your items.
  10. Make it easy for shoppers to test electronic items.  Have an extension cord handy so that people can test them.
  11. Be willing to bargain, but be less flexible at the start.
  12. Know what your ground rules are  when it comes to bargaining.  Customers will always bargain, they want a deal.
  13. Keep a ledger.  Jot down a description of each item and how much you sold it for.
  14. DO NOT use a cash box.  Keep your money on you at all times.

 

The whole idea of this garage sale is to get rid of all the stuff you are not moving to your new home.  Your goal is to recycle all those items that are still usefull – TO SOMEONE ELSE.

A successfull garage sale, starts with good organizing, price all your items, this gives the customer an idea of what you want for the item, without a price customers may overlook the item since a offer may offend you.  Display the items so you can encourage customers to come, LOOK, AND BUY.
